Locale::Maketext::Lexicon::Properties - Properties file parser for Maketext
Called via Locale::Maketext::Lexicon:
package Hello::I18N; use parent 'Locale::Maketext'; use Locale::Maketext::Lexicon { en => [ Properties => "en_US/hello.properties" ], }; package main; my $lh = Hello::I18N->get_handle('en'); print $lh->maketext('foo');
Directly calling Locale::Maketext::Lexicon::Properties::parse():
Locale::Maketext::Lexicon::Properties::parse()
use Locale::Maketext::Lexicon::Properties; my %lexicon = %{ Locale::Maketext::Lexicon::Properties->parse(<DATA>) }; __DATA__ foo=bar baz=qux
This module parses .properties file (from Java) for Locale::Maketext by using Locale::Maketext::Lexicon. And it can also returns a Lexicon hash.
You can lookup the property value by specifying key to maketext() or Lexcon hash.

To install Locale::Maketext::Lexicon::Properties, copy and paste the appropriate command in to your terminal.
cpanm
cpanm Locale::Maketext::Lexicon::Properties
CPAN shell
perl -MCPAN -e shell install Locale::Maketext::Lexicon::Properties
